The visible location of a water leak in a Brentwood home is rarely the source of the leak โ€” water follows the path of least resistance and can travel 6โ€“8 feet from a pinhole failure before dripping somewhere visible. A wet ceiling stain directly beneath a bathroom doesn't necessarily mean the problem is directly above it. A leak below a sink cabinet may be coming from a supply fitting, the drain, the garbage disposal connection, or the faucet base. We trace leaks to their actual source in Prince George's County homes before recommending repair โ€” because fixing the wrong location produces a second service call, not a solution.

Heat pump water heaters are the highest-efficiency category of electric water heater available to Brentwood homeowners โ€” operating at 2 to 3 times the efficiency of standard electric resistance units by extracting heat from ambient air rather than generating it electrically. The tradeoff is space requirement: these units need at least 700โ€“1,000 cubic feet of air volume to operate efficiently, making them unsuitable for small utility closets. They also emit cooled, dehumidified air as a byproduct โ€” a benefit in warm months, a consideration in conditioned spaces during winter. In Prince George's County's climate, heat pump water heaters offer substantial operating cost savings for homes with the right installation conditions.

Trenchless sewer rehabilitation has changed the cost profile of sewer line repair in Brentwood significantly. Pipe lining (CIPP) inserts a resin-saturated liner into the existing pipe, cures it in place, and leaves a structural new pipe inside the old one โ€” without excavation. Pipe bursting pushes a new pipe through the path of the old one, displacing it outward. Both methods restore full function with minimal disturbance to landscaping and hardscape. Braided stainless supply lines connecting shutoff valves to faucets and toilets in Brentwood homes have a finite service life โ€” typically 8โ€“10 years before the end fittings begin to degrade under constant water pressure. Unlike slow-developing drain clogs, supply line failures can be sudden and high-volume. We recommend replacing all braided stainless supply lines in Prince George's County homes at the 8-10 year mark as a scheduled maintenance item โ€” the cost is $5โ€“$15 per line, and the labor is minimal when done proactively. The comparison to a supply line that fails and dumps its full flow rate under a sink or behind a toilet for hours makes the math straightforward.

  • Schedule annual water heater maintenance โ€” Flushing sediment, inspecting the anode rod, and testing the pressure relief valve annually can add 3โ€“5 years to your water heater's service life and prevent the most common failure modes.
